Output 0ec4b8fff7a53d65526a244beff860f0e018cf096a8c36195fd6c6827b8af1af:27

value
2101329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fba7e7d0811793a815265fd1424411a3e675f74 OP_EQUAL
address
363P6PxjFkrHKznAMzRYDLae9qXY2UdmnE
transaction
0ec4b8fff7a53d65526a244beff860f0e018cf096a8c36195fd6c6827b8af1af
spent
true